Make a difference as a School Psychologist in a dynamic school environment near Edinburgh, IN. This contract role offers the opportunity to play a key part in the special education process, working onsite Monday through Friday from 7:45 AM to 3:15 PM.

As the dedicated School Psychologist, you’ll work closely with students, families, and staff across three school buildings, providing essential support for special education evaluations and fostering an inclusive, supportive educational environment.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Conduct approximately 70 psycho educational evaluations per year
  • Collaborate with educators and families to develop comprehensive plans for student support
  • Ensure all evaluations and documentation meet Indiana special education requirements
  • Provide consultative services to staff on intervention strategies and educational planning
  • Participate actively in monthly team meetings
  • Report directly to the district supervisor, maintaining open lines of communication
Desired

Qualifications:
  • Valid Indiana School Psychologist license
  • Practical experience in psycho educational assessments and eligibility determinations preferred
  • In-depth understanding of special education law, procedures, and compliance
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ills for working with a variety of stakeholders
  • Collaborative approach to problem-solving and team participation
